Travel insurance is often surrounded by misconceptions that can lead to misunderstandings when it comes to securing the right coverage. One of the most common myths is that travel insurance is only necessary for international trips. In reality, it can be just as essential for domestic travel, where unexpected events like trip cancellations, medical emergencies, or lost luggage can occur. Travel insurance provides peace of mind, ensuring that you are protected no matter where your journey takes you.
Another prevalent misconception is that all travel insurance policies are the same. In fact, coverage can vary widely depending on the policy and provider. Some travelers believe they are fully covered simply because they purchased a policy, but it's crucial to read the fine print. Elements such as coverage limits, exclusions, and specific protection for adventure activities can significantly impact your overall safety. By understanding the details, you can make an informed choice and avoid any unpleasant surprises during your travels.
Travel insurance is a vital safety net for any traveler, offering a range of protections that can save you from significant financial loss. Typically, travel insurance covers several key areas, including trip cancellations and interruptions, medical emergencies, lost or delayed baggage, and travel delays. In the event of unforeseen circumstances, such as natural disasters or illness, having travel insurance ensures that you can recover costs associated with non-refundable bookings. It is essential to review your policy to understand the specific coverages and limits, as not all travel insurance plans are created equal.
Among the various types of coverage, medical expenses are one of the most critical aspects of travel insurance. This coverage can include emergency medical treatment, hospital stays, and evacuation if necessary. Additionally, many plans offer trip cancellation coverage, which reimburses your prepaid expenses if you need to cancel your trip due to covered reasons, like illness or a family emergency. Consider purchasing a policy that also includes personal liability coverage to protect you in case of injury or damage to property while traveling. Always read the fine print and ask questions before purchasing to ensure your specific needs are met.
